Rancho Cucamonga, CA vs Salem, OR
Salem is cheaper — estimated essentials for a single person run about $871/mo less, and living comfortably there takes roughly $15,500 less in annual salary (taxes included).
| Metric | Rancho Cucamonga62 | Salem59 |
|---|---|---|
| Est. monthly cost (single) | $4,886 | $4,015 |
| Est. monthly cost (family of 4, incl. childcare) | $10,593 | $9,433 |
| Salary for comfort | $94,500/yr | $79,000/yr |
| Typical rent | $2,286 | $1,560 |
| Median home value | $694,400 | $382,400 |
| Median household income | $109,511 | $71,900 |
| Unemployment | 4.3% | 5.2% |
| Housing score | 38 | 45 |
| Jobs score | 47 | 48 |
| Safety score | 77 | 47 |
| Climate score | 100 | 97 |
| Amenities score | 50 | 21 |
| Population | 174.7K | 176.7K |
| Summer high / winter low | 92° / 44° | 82° / 35° |
Fit scores use the reference profile (single, $6,700/mo gross, default weights). Green marks the better value per row.
